Advice for Potential Travellers
This is a fantastic trip to do and i would definately recommend this to anyone, Vancouver Island is a stunning place. Just be aware that seeing wildlife is not guaranteed and just make the most of what you do see. I would suggest taking a small waterproof bag to hold your camera and binoculars for the bear and whale watching on the zodiacs as you can't take a big bag and you don't want to get your camera wet.If you do the kayaking then take a set of dry clothes to change into as you will get wet and i would also advise a hat as my head got a bit burnt and being out for 3 hours you need to be careful.I would also suggest participating in as many of the optional activities as you can as these for me really added to the trip for me, the snorkelling with seals was great fun and the seals were so relaxed on the island occassionally taking a dip in the sea. The kayaking as also great fun, although this is not with whales but round the little islands, it is lovely to see the starfish, fish etc.
